I know this is an old thread, but I thought I'd post my results here and bump in case anybody's interested.
I've been putting pure E-85 into my 2008 G35x without any problems yet. I'm in five tankfuls, so I can't speak for longevity.
As for power, and the car is bone-stock, I made some 1/4 mile runs today with an accelerometer, and was running a high 14 (we're in Denver, so remember altitude power losses for being at 5,200 feet). Based on car weight and this 1/4 mile time, I calculated roughly 260 WHP, definitely not "significantly decreased performance" like people seem to think.
I used pure E-85 in my old '96 Mercedes E320 for almost two years, and never had a damaged fuel line, injector, or anything.
